双层多目标优化问题进化算法

双层多目标优化问题进化算法

ID:23616256

大小:670.91 KB

页数:35页

时间:2018-11-09

双层多目标优化问题进化算法_第1页
双层多目标优化问题进化算法_第2页
双层多目标优化问题进化算法_第3页
双层多目标优化问题进化算法_第4页
双层多目标优化问题进化算法_第5页
资源描述:

《双层多目标优化问题进化算法》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库

1、青海师范大学学位论文独创性声明本人声明所呈交的学位论文是我个人在导师指导下进行的研究工作及取得的研究成果。尽我所知,除了文中特别加以标注和致谢的地方外,论文中不包含他人已发表或撰写过的研究成果,也不包含为获得青海师范大学或其他教育机构的学位或证书而使用过的材料。与我一同工作的同志对本研究所做的任何贡献均已在论文中作了明确的说明并表示了谢意。研究生签名:日期:青海师范大学学位论文使用授权声明青海师范大学、中国科学技术信息研究所、国家图书馆有权保留本人所送交学位论文的复印件和电子文档,可以采用影印、缩印或其他复制手段保存论文。本人电子文档的内容和纸质论文的内容相一致。除在保密期内的保密

2、论文外,允许论文被查阅和借阅,可以公布(或刊登)论文的全部或部分内容。论文的(包括刊登)授权由青海师范大学研究生部办理。研究生签名:导师签名:日期:I万方数据中文摘要双层规划问题是一类递阶优化问题,在经济管理、军事等领域有广泛的应用背景.该问题的特点是,一个问题的约束域受另一个问题的最优性影响,是一个强-NP难问题.多目标优化问题存在多个优化目标,且这些目标往往是相互对立的.双层多目标优化问题是上下层目标至少有一个是多目标函数的双层规划问题,该问题具有单目标双层规划问题的递阶结构,同时具有多目标优化问题的特点,这使得该问题具有重要的理论研究意义和实践价值,但对问题的求解也变得较为复

3、杂.目前存在的方法往往利用K-K-T条件等将双层问题转化为单层,然后利用单层多目标优化方法来解决,但转化后变量急剧增加,求解效率不高.本文主要研究了两类常见的双层多目标优化问题,并设计了相应的进化算法.1.针对上层多目标下层单目标的双层优化问题,在下层最优解唯一的假设下,提出了一个基于NSGA-II框架和插值技术的进化算法.首先,通过一些样本点,利用插值函数拟合下层解函数.其次,上层目标函数利用NSGA-II算法框架进行进化,对于每一个上层变量值,利用插值函数获得近似下层最优解.为了获得精确的下层解,在每一代,对获得的若干较好个体进行下层解的修正,并作为新的插值点修正插值函数.最后

4、,为了减少计算量,我们设计了一个多标准进化过程,使得多个点的修正过程在一次进化中完成.2.针对上下层目标函数均为多目标的情况,我们首先采用均匀设计的原理对下层的各个子函数进行加权求和,从而将下层问题转化为若干个单目标问题.其次,上层采用NSGA-II框架进行进化,对于每一个上层变量值,利用取定的权值对下层目标求和,并求解对应的单目标下层问题.数值试验结果表明,该方法是可行有效的.关键词:进化算法,双层多目标规划,Pareto最优解,插值函数,非支配排序,均匀设计I万方数据AbstractBilevelprogrammingproblemsareaclassofhierarchica

5、loptimizationproblems,whichareusedinmanyareasextensively,suchaseconomyandmanagementandmilitary,etc.Theproblemischaracterizedbythefactthattheconstraintregionofoneoptimizationproblemisdeterminedbytheoptimalityofanother,andisstrongly-NP.Foramulti-objectiveoptimizationproblem,thereismorethanoneobj

6、ectiveintheobjectivefunctionandtheseobjectivesusuallycontradictwitheachother.Bilevelmulti-objectiveoptimizationinvolvesatleastonemulti-objectivefunctionintheleader’sandthefollower’sobjectives,withbilevelhierarchicalstructureaswellasfeaturesofmulti-objectiveoptimization,makingtheproblemhaveimpo

7、rtanttheoreticandpracticevalues.However,ontheotherhand,thefeaturemakestheproblemhardertosolve.Atpresent,thereexistsometransformingapproaches,suchasK-K-Tconditions,theyconvertbilevelmodelintoasingle-levelcase,andusesingle-levelmulti-obje

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。